I got a problem with a CRM Workflow which handels our incidents.
I created a workflow which is triggered every time a new E-Mail arrives in the CRM that is sent to our support E-Mail and is refferd to an incident in CRM.
This workflow checks if the status of the incident is active and if yes the owner of the incident gets a notification E-Mail that the customer has responded to his ticket. This works totally fine.
If the status is not active when the customer answers, the case should be reactivated (Status set to active) and the owner should be set to our systemadmin which also all works fine.
The problem is now if a case is reactivated by the workflow, all Actitivites (E-Mails) that are attached to the case change their date/time to that of the newest E-Mail which reactivated the case. This is really bad because like this the order of the conversation is wrong and we can't see from when the E-Mail is.
Has anyone an idea why this happens or how I can modify the workflow that it does not happen?
